How to Find the Best Car Insurance for Your Specific Vehicle in Australia

Finding the best car insurance for your specific vehicle in Australia involves several key steps to ensure you get the coverage that suits your needs and budget. Here’s a comprehensive guide to help you through the process.

Understand Your Vehicle's Needs

Every vehicle is different, and its insurance needs will vary based on factors such as age, make, model, and usage. Luxury cars, for example, will generally cost more to insure than economy models. Consider the following:

  • Vehicle Age: Newer vehicles may require comprehensive coverage, while older cars may only need third-party insurance.
  • Make and Model: Research the insurance ratings of your vehicle's brand. High-performance or luxury brands often come with higher premiums.
  • Usage: Consider how often and for what purpose you use your car. Business use may require different coverage compared to personal use.

Compare Insurance Policies

Utilizing online comparison tools can help you evaluate different insurance policies side by side. Look for the following:

  • Coverage Types: Analyze what type of coverage each policy offers: comprehensive, third-party property, third-party fire and theft, etc.
  • Premiums: Compare the cost of premiums. While a lower premium is appealing, ensure you're not sacrificing essential coverage.
  • Excess Amounts: Be aware of the excess you'll have to pay in case of a claim. Higher excess can lower your premium but could cost you more in the event of an accident.

Consider Discounts and Bundles

Many Australian insurers offer various discounts that can significantly lower your premium:

  • No-Claim Bonus: If you have a good driving record, you may qualify for a no-claim bonus, reducing your premium.
  • Multi-Policy Discounts: Bundling your car insurance with other policies, like home insurance, can result in savings.
  • Membership Discounts: Certain organizations or clubs offer discounts for their members, so it’s worth inquiring.

Understand Policy Inclusions and Exclusions

It’s crucial to thoroughly read the policy documents to understand what is included and what is not. Pay attention to:

  • Inclusions: Ensure that essential features (like roadside assistance or rental car coverage) are part of your policy.
  • Exclusions: Familiarize yourself with what is excluded, which can avoid surprises when making a claim. Common exclusions include damages caused by negligence, driving without a license, or using the vehicle for illegal activities.
